Day 178: Salvia 'Hot Lips'

Daily details from the garden to bring you inspiration throughout the year

I put my faith in Hot Lips this year. Salvia ‘Hot Lips’, I should specify, for the removal of any misunderstanding – shrubby, fairly hardy, generally reliable. But last winter seems to have hit it hard in all my gardens and, in spite of my confidence that it would bounce back, it’s taken its time and a good proportion of the established framework has been looking unusually bare. Until now – not before time, my stalwart old friend has rewarded my trust with foliage and flowers and, in those cases where I felt obliged to hedge my bets and cut it back hard, I’m sure we can just call that rejuvenative pruning.
